- /// LookupFile - Given a "foo" or <foo> reference, look up the indicated file,
- /// return null on failure. isAngled indicates whether the file reference is
- /// for system #include's or not (i.e. using <> instead of ""). CurFileEnt, if
- /// non-null, indicates where the #including file is, in case a relative search
- /// is needed.
- const FileEntry *HeaderSearch::LookupFile(const char *FilenameStart,
- const char *FilenameEnd,
- bool isAngled,
- const DirectoryLookup *FromDir,
- const DirectoryLookup *&CurDir,
- const FileEntry *CurFileEnt) {
- // If 'Filename' is absolute, check to see if it exists and no searching.
- // FIXME: Portability. This should be a sys::Path interface, this doesn't
- // handle things like C:\foo.txt right, nor win32 \\network\device\blah.
- if (FilenameStart[0] == '/') {
- CurDir = 0;
- // If this was an #include_next "/absolute/file", fail.
- if (FromDir) return 0;
-
- // Otherwise, just return the file.
- return FileMgr.getFile(FilenameStart, FilenameEnd);
- }
-
- llvm::SmallString<1024> TmpDir;
-
- // Step #0, unless disabled, check to see if the file is in the #includer's
- // directory. This search is not done for <> headers.
- if (CurFileEnt && !isAngled && !NoCurDirSearch) {
- // Concatenate the requested file onto the directory.
- // FIXME: Portability. Filename concatenation should be in sys::Path.
- TmpDir += CurFileEnt->getDir()->getName();
- TmpDir.push_back('/');
- TmpDir.append(FilenameStart, FilenameEnd);
- if (const FileEntry *FE = FileMgr.getFile(TmpDir.begin(), TmpDir.end())) {
- // Leave CurDir unset.
-
- // This file is a system header or C++ unfriendly if the old file is.
- getFileInfo(FE).DirInfo = getFileInfo(CurFileEnt).DirInfo;
- return FE;
- }
- TmpDir.clear();
- }
-
- CurDir = 0;
- // If this is a system #include, ignore the user #include locs.
- unsigned i = isAngled ? SystemDirIdx : 0;
-
- // If this is a #include_next request, start searching after the directory the
- // file was found in.
- if (FromDir)
- i = FromDir-&SearchDirs[0];
-
- // Check each directory in sequence to see if it contains this file.
- for (; i != SearchDirs.size(); ++i) {
- const FileEntry *FE = 0;
- if (!SearchDirs[i].isFramework()) {
- // FIXME: Portability. Adding file to dir should be in sys::Path.
- // Concatenate the requested file onto the directory.
- TmpDir.clear();
- TmpDir += SearchDirs[i].getDir()->getName();
- TmpDir.push_back('/');
- TmpDir.append(FilenameStart, FilenameEnd);
- FE = FileMgr.getFile(TmpDir.begin(), TmpDir.end());
- } else {
- FE = DoFrameworkLookup(SearchDirs[i].getDir(), FilenameStart,FilenameEnd);
- }
-
- if (FE) {
- CurDir = &SearchDirs[i];
-
- // This file is a system header or C++ unfriendly if the dir is.
- getFileInfo(FE).DirInfo = CurDir->getDirCharacteristic();
- return FE;
- }
- }
-
- // Otherwise, didn't find it.
- return 0;
- }
- /// LookupSubframeworkHeader - Look up a subframework for the specified
- /// #include file. For example, if #include'ing <HIToolbox/HIToolbox.h> from
- /// within ".../Carbon.framework/Headers/Carbon.h", check to see if HIToolbox
- /// is a subframework within Carbon.framework. If so, return the FileEntry
- /// for the designated file, otherwise return null.
- const FileEntry *HeaderSearch::
- LookupSubframeworkHeader(const char *FilenameStart,
- const char *FilenameEnd,
- const FileEntry *ContextFileEnt) {
- // Framework names must have a '/' in the filename. Find it.
- const char *SlashPos = std::find(FilenameStart, FilenameEnd, '/');
- if (SlashPos == FilenameEnd) return 0;
-
- // Look up the base framework name of the ContextFileEnt.
- const char *ContextName = ContextFileEnt->getName();
-
- // If the context info wasn't a framework, couldn't be a subframework.
- const char *FrameworkPos = strstr(ContextName, ".framework/");
- if (FrameworkPos == 0)
- return 0;
-
- llvm::SmallString<1024> FrameworkName(ContextName,
- FrameworkPos+strlen(".framework/"));
- // Append Frameworks/HIToolbox.framework/
- FrameworkName += "Frameworks/";
- FrameworkName.append(FilenameStart, SlashPos);
- FrameworkName += ".framework/";
- llvm::StringMapEntry<const DirectoryEntry *> &CacheLookup =
- FrameworkMap.GetOrCreateValue(FilenameStart, SlashPos);
-
- // Some other location?
- if (CacheLookup.getValue() &&
- CacheLookup.getKeyLength() == FrameworkName.size() &&
- memcmp(CacheLookup.getKeyData(), &FrameworkName[0],
- CacheLookup.getKeyLength()) != 0)
- return 0;
-
- // Cache subframework.
- if (CacheLookup.getValue() == 0) {
- ++NumSubFrameworkLookups;
-
- // If the framework dir doesn't exist, we fail.
- const DirectoryEntry *Dir = FileMgr.getDirectory(FrameworkName.begin(),
- FrameworkName.end());
- if (Dir == 0) return 0;
-
- // Otherwise, if it does, remember that this is the right direntry for this
- // framework.
- CacheLookup.setValue(Dir);
- }
-
- const FileEntry *FE = 0;
- // Check ".../Frameworks/HIToolbox.framework/Headers/HIToolbox.h"
- llvm::SmallString<1024> HeadersFilename(FrameworkName);
- HeadersFilename += "Headers/";
- HeadersFilename.append(SlashPos+1, FilenameEnd);
- if (!(FE = FileMgr.getFile(HeadersFilename.begin(),
- HeadersFilename.end()))) {
-
- // Check ".../Frameworks/HIToolbox.framework/PrivateHeaders/HIToolbox.h"
- HeadersFilename = FrameworkName;
- HeadersFilename += "PrivateHeaders/";
- HeadersFilename.append(SlashPos+1, FilenameEnd);
- if (!(FE = FileMgr.getFile(HeadersFilename.begin(), HeadersFilename.end())))
- return 0;
- }
-
- // This file is a system header or C++ unfriendly if the old file is.
- getFileInfo(FE).DirInfo = getFileInfo(ContextFileEnt).DirInfo;
- return FE;
- }

- /// ShouldEnterIncludeFile - Mark the specified file as a target of of a
- /// #include, #include_next, or #import directive. Return false if #including
- /// the file will have no effect or true if we should include it.
- bool HeaderSearch::ShouldEnterIncludeFile(const FileEntry *File, bool isImport){
- ++NumIncluded; // Count # of attempted #includes.
- // Get information about this file.
- PerFileInfo &FileInfo = getFileInfo(File);
-
- // If this is a #import directive, check that we have not already imported
- // this header.
- if (isImport) {
- // If this has already been imported, don't import it again.
- FileInfo.isImport = true;
-
- // Has this already been #import'ed or #include'd?
- if (FileInfo.NumIncludes) return false;
- } else {
- // Otherwise, if this is a #include of a file that was previously #import'd
- // or if this is the second #include of a #pragma once file, ignore it.
- if (FileInfo.isImport)
- return false;
- }
-
- // Next, check to see if the file is wrapped with #ifndef guards. If so, and
- // if the macro that guards it is defined, we know the #include has no effect.
- if (FileInfo.ControllingMacro && FileInfo.ControllingMacro->getMacroInfo()) {
- ++NumMultiIncludeFileOptzn;
- return false;
- }
-
- // Increment the number of times this file has been included.
- ++FileInfo.NumIncludes;
-
- return true;
- }
